    Currently 8,057 rounds, 19 loads total, 2 new loads, still only 1 ammo related stoppage to date. FASTs are running ~5.5-6, consistent “Dark Pin” runs, with less consistent “Light Pins.” LAV “tests” in the 6-7 sec range. I shot some other 19Xs equipped with OEM night sights, reinforcing my strong preference for the Ameriglo Agents on my gun. The BlackPoint holster pictured and another variant are GTG. New RSA installed.


    • 50 Black Hills Ammunition 115 TAC-XP
    • 4643 Black Hills Ammunition 115 FMJ
    • 90 Black Hills Ammunition 124 JHP-XTP
    • 171 Black Hills Ammunition 124 JHP-XTP +P
    • 117 Black Hills Ammunition Honey Badger
    • 90 Federal 147 HST
    • 90 Speer 147 GDHP G2
    • 48 Federal 147 JHP
    • 233 Speer Lawman 124 TMJ
    • 400 Speer Lawman 147 TMJ
    • 220 Federal AE 115 FMJ
    • 808 Federal AE 147 FMJ
    • 93 Blazer Brass 115 FMJ
    • 50 Blazer Brass 124 FMJ
    • *100 ICC Green Elite 100 lead free frang
    • 135 Remington Disintegrator 101 lead free frang
    • 162 Speer Lawman 100 RHT lead free frang
    • 377 Ultramax 115 FMJ reman
    • 180 Winchester 115 FMJ (Q4172)

    Love my 19X. Local gunshop didn't have a Gen5 19 in stock and the salesman handed me one. The balance caught my immediate attention and I prefer the Gen5 triggers. I just swapped out the stock sights for a set of Wilson Combats. The only other modification I intend to make is switching out the trigger shoe, probably with the new one from Tango Down.

    The only negative things I could say are minor: The finish has shown a little more holster wear than I would have expected, and I'm still trying to figure out the purpose of that lip extension thingy on the front of the grip. I think this one will be a surprise winner for Glock, especially when the black version comes out.
